Volunteer Vehicle Driver

OverviewAs a LifeWise vehicle driver, you will provide safe and reliable transportation for public school students to and from the LifeWise site. Our ideal candidate is responsible and punctual and has a clean driving record. If you're interested in this position, apply on the program's webpage.Qualifications and ExperienceA mature personal Christian faith in agreement with the "What We Believe" section of the LifeWise Academy Statement of FaithActive participation in and commitment to a local church whose doctrine aligns with the "What We Believe" section of the LifeWise Academy Statement of FaithRegular driver's license (a copy may be kept on file by the LifeWise program)The driver is required to have been continuously licensed for the past three yearsAppropriate special licensesVehicles seating more than 15 passengers: Commercial Driver's License (CDL) with endorsement for driving a passenger vehicle (P)15 passenger van: no special license requiredAge requirement: 21-80 years of ageAny driver above the age of 75 is required to submit additional documentation as follows:Van Drivers over the age of 75: Submit an annual Physician's Statement via support ticketCDL Licensed Drivers over the age of 75: Submit a copy of their CDL license and (P) Passenger Endorsement annually via support ticketClean driving record with no at-fault accidents or traffic citations within the last five years. If the candidate does have at-fault accidents or traffic citations, contact your Program Coach who will then reach out to the HR Team to determine the candidate's employment eligibility.Undergo and pass a background check through LifeWise AcademyAll drivers with known medical conditions are required to obtain a yearly underwriter-approved Physician's Statement (refer to this Physician's Statement from Brotherhood Mutual).Complete drug and/or alcohol testing as required. Drug testing will be conducted for pre-employment, annual random tests and following traffic accidents.Job Responsibilities OverviewTransport children and LifeWise volunteers to and from the LifeWise siteObey traffic lawsMaintain the cleanliness and mechanical safety of the busPerform regular inspections of the busRefuel the vehicle as neededCreate and maintain a safe environment for childrenEnforce safety rules for studentsAssist students with entering or exiting the vehicle as neededDemonstrate a calm and caring demeanorBe aware of which students need help or are misbehavingVolunteer in the LifeWise classroom if agreed upon with the DirectorLifeWise Academy's hiring practices and EEO Statement are fully in compliance with both federal and state law. Federal law creates an exception to the "religion" section of employment discrimination laws for religious organizations and permits them to give employment preference to members of their own religion. LifeWise Academy is in that category.Classification: Non-Exempt (Hourly)Employment Type: Volunteer
